New Balance: A Brief History

Before we delve into the comfort factor, let's take a quick peek into the history of New Balance. Established in 1906, New Balance has been around the block a time or two. They started as a small, family-owned business, and now they're a global brand, known for their quality, durability, and, of course, comfort. So, you can trust they've had plenty of time to perfect their craft.

What Makes New Balance Shoes Comfortable?

New Balance shoes are designed with comfort at the forefront. Here are a few reasons why you might find them comfortable:

Abzorb Midsole

New Balance's Abzorb midsole is like a little cloud of cushioning in the sole of their shoes. It's designed to absorb and disperse impact, reducing the stress on your feet, ankles, and knees. This midsole technology is a significant contributor to the comfort New Balance shoes are known for.

Secure Fit

New Balance shoes often feature a secure, snug fit that hugs your feet without feeling too tight. This is thanks to their unique designs, which often include overlays that help lock your foot in place. A secure fit can prevent your feet from sliding around inside your shoes, which can lead to blisters and discomfort.

Durability

New Balance shoes are built to last. The durability of these shoes means they won't fall apart after a few wears, which can cause discomfort and force you to shell out cash for new kicks. Plus, the more you wear them, the more they mold to your feet, increasing comfort over time.

But Are They Too Cushy?

While the cushioning in New Balance shoes is a major selling point, some people might find it a bit too much. If you're used to minimalist shoes or running barefoot, the plush cushioning might feel strange at first. It's all about personal preference, so it's worth trying on a pair to see how they feel.

Which New Balance Shoes Are the Most Comfortable?

New Balance offers a wide range of shoes, from running sneakers to casual kicks. Here are a few models known for their comfort:

New Balance Fresh Foam 1080v11

The Fresh Foam 1080v11 is a running shoe that's all about comfort. The full-length Fresh Foam midsole provides plenty of cushioning, while the engineered mesh upper offers a secure, breathable fit.

New Balance 990v5

The 990v5 is a classic New Balance shoe that's beloved for its comfort. It features a dual-density midsole for cushioning and support, and the leather upper provides a snug, secure fit.

New Balance 574 Classic

If you're looking for a comfortable casual shoe, the 574 Classic is a great option. It features a leather upper and a thick, cushioned midsole, making it a comfy choice for everyday wear.

How to Ensure New Balance Shoes Stay Comfortable

To keep your New Balance shoes feeling comfy, here are a few tips:

- Break them in gradually. Don't wear them for hours on end on your first go. Start with short walks and gradually increase your wear time. - Rotate your shoes. Don't wear the same pair every day. Giving your shoes a rest allows them to recover and maintain their cushioning. - Keep them clean. Regular cleaning can help prevent odors and keep your shoes looking and feeling fresh.

Common Complaints About New Balance Shoes

While many people rave about the comfort of New Balance shoes, they're not without their criticisms. Here are a few common complaints:

- They can be expensive. New Balance shoes often come with a higher price tag, which can be a turn-off for some. - They might not be wide enough. Some people find New Balance shoes too narrow, which can lead to discomfort. - The style might not be for everyone. New Balance shoes have a distinct look, and not everyone is a fan of their classic, old-school aesthetic.
